Understand Your Necklines

The first step in choosing the right necklace length is to consider the neckline of your outfit. The interaction between your necklace and neckline can create a harmonious and flattering look. Here’s a breakdown of popular necklines and their pairings:

  • Crew Neck: For high necklines like a crew neck, go for shorter necklaces such as chokers or collars. These lengths sit above the neckline, adding a focal point close to your face. Our Billie Collar Necklace, with its subtle beadwork, is a perfect choice for this look!
  • V-Neck: A V-neckline calls for a necklace that mimics the shape of the neckline. A pendant necklace that falls just above or at the V-point can elongate your neck and create a balanced appearance.   • Strapless or Off-the-Shoulder: For strapless or off-the-shoulder tops, the possibilities are endless. You can go for statement pieces or layered strands that draw attention to your neck. For example, the Odyssey Necklace adds drama and sophistication to this neckline.
  • Boat Neck: Boat necklines are best paired with longer pieces that extend below the neckline, like opera or rope lengths. These styles create a vertical line that can elongate your torso.
  • Sweetheart Neckline: Sweetheart necklines pair beautifully with shorter, more delicate pieces that follow the curve of the neckline. Consider Your Body Type

Your body type can also play a role in selecting the right necklace length. The goal is always to choose a length that enhances your features and creates a balanced look. Here are a few common body types and the pieces that pair best with each:

  • Petite Frames: If you have a petite frame, shorter necklaces (14-18 inches) can help avoid overwhelming your proportions. Chokers, collars, and princess lengths are great options to keep the focus near your face without adding bulk.
  • Tall and Slim: Tall and slim figures can carry longer pieces (20-36 inches) with ease. Opera and rope lengths can add drama and break up your vertical lines, creating a balanced look. Experiment with layering different lengths for added dimension!
  • Curvy Figures: For curvy body types, choosing the right necklace length can help accentuate your curves without adding extra volume. Mid-length options (20-24 inches) that rest on your neck are flattering and create a focal point without overwhelming your frame.
  • Full Bust: If you have a fuller bust, choose pieces that sit just above or below the bust line (18-22 inches). Avoid necklaces that rest directly on the bust, as they can create an unbalanced look.
